What alcohol is in a rusty nail?

A Rusty Nail is made by mixing Drambuie and Scotch whisky. The drink was included in Difford's Guide's Top 100 Cocktails. A Rusty Nail can be served in an old-fashioned glass on the rocks, neat, or "up" in a stemmed glass. It is most commonly served over ice.

How deep does a rusty nail cause tetanus?

Rust doesn't cause tetanus, but stepping on a nail might if you're not immunized. In fact, any damage to the skin, even burns and blisters, allows tetanus-causing bacteria to enter the body. Tetanus is not as common as it once was. Still, tetanus patients have only about a 50-50 chance of recovering.

What is a Benedictine drink?

Bénédictine D.O.M. is an herbal liqueur produced in France. Its recipe comes from a 16th-century monk and includes a secret blend of 27 herbs and spices in a neutral spirit that's sweetened with honey. It may be an old liqueur but it has a well-deserved place in the modern bar.

What does bottled in bond whiskey mean?

Another term you might see on a bottle is Bottled-in-Bond or Bonded. This means the bourbon was made at a single distillery, by one distiller in one distillation season, aged for at least four years in a federally bonded and supervised warehouse, and bottled at 100 proof.

What spices are in Drambuie?

A couple of things that have been suggested are anise, nutmeg, and saffron. The honey, spices and herbs are infused into aged Speyside and Highland malt whiskies, creating what the company calls an elixir.

Does Drambuie taste like licorice?

What Does Drambuie Taste Like? The honey isn't an ordinary, chalky honey from the grocery store, but heather honey from Scotland, which tastes strongly of hay (in a good way). Orange zest, licorice and cinnamon stand out among the added botanical flavors.
